Set Visit Video for TRANSFORMERS: DARK OF THE MOON
Published: October 29, 2010 - 10:01am
A compilation of set visits from Transformers: Dark of the Moon has been put together while the production was shot on the streets of Chicago.

The cast and crew talk to Entertainment Tonight about where this movie is heading. Transformers: Dark of the Moon, set for release on July 1, 2011 in 3D, is directed by Michael Bay. It stars Shia LaBeouf, Rosie Huntington-Whiteley, Josh Duhamel, Tyrese Gibson, Patrick Dempsey, John Turturro, Alan Tudyk, Ken Jeong and John Malkovich.
Shia Lebeouf on this installment:
"I think what we were lacking in the second movie was heart," says Shia about the last installment of the blockbuster franchise, '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en.' "But, I think with the addition of Rosie and new characters … you still have the magic of the first film, but you have depth in the ending of the third."
"Sam's coming out of heartbreak," explains Shia about the film's emotional center. "He's looking for a rock. He's looking for stability. He's looking for a person who doesn't love him because of his involvement in the wars, or because of his involvement with the robots. … And, so he's looking to define himself and find a person who understands the definition and loves him for him, and he finds it in Rosie."
